Design, development and marketing consulting in Texas

Fahrenheit Marketing, founded in 2008, provides web design, development, and digital marketing solutions, digital marketing, automation strategies, and pay-per-click (PPC) advertising for customers and local businesses aiming to boost their brand exposure. Fahrenheit's marketing professionals offer various services, including creating and enhancing websites using advanced graphic design techniques. Moreover, they utilize exceptional UI/UX designers and developers to generate superior client web experiences. Fahrenheit also provides ongoing analysis, A/B testing, and e-campaigns to partners. In addition, their search engine optimization (SEO) service utilizes strategies such as generating content, researching keywords, appropriately labeling and categorizing content, and constructing links.

Overall Experience: As we grew our company and had a SEO strategy, we needed high quality backlinks. We went with quality over quantity. It started with an onboarding call, in which we discussed what we're looking to get out of this project and any specific keywords they should look for. After that, they did their research on the company website and its digital footprint and which keywords to target. They then delivered the agreed upon links every month with a report summarizing the link and its DA score.
